New Members ppolsen Posted August 31, 2014 New Members Share Posted August 31, 2014 Hello, Me my girlfriend and I found this pebble on Brighton beach. I looks like some kind of squid tentacle impression. Hope someone could tell us what it is.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Auspex Posted August 31, 2014 Share Posted August 31, 2014 These fascinating marks are an impression of an echinoid (sea urchin) test (shell). The main pits are where the spines attached.
